Boundary fence installation services involve the construction of fences that define property lines, providing clear separation between neighboring properties. These services typically include assessing the property boundaries, selecting appropriate fencing materials, and installing the fence securely along the designated line. Local contractors often handle everything from initial site preparation to final installation, ensuring the fence is durable and meets the property owner’s needs. Proper boundary fencing helps prevent disputes over land limits and creates a defined perimeter for the property.

The overview below groups typical Boundary Fence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or fence repairs or small sections usually fall between $250 and $600. Many routine jobs in this range are completed quickly and with minimal materials, making them the most common projects contractors handle.

Standard Fence Installation - Installing a new boundary fence typically costs between $1,500 and $3,500 for most residential projects. This range covers common materials and moderate-sized yards, which are the majority of installations performed by local contractors.

Full Fence Replacement - Replacing an existing fence with a new one can range from $3,500 to $7,000 or more, depending on the size and material choices. Larger, more complex projects or premium materials can push costs higher, but these are less frequent than standard replacements.

Larger or Custom Projects - Extensive or custom boundary fencing projects, such as privacy fences or specialty materials, can exceed $7,000 and reach $10,000+ in some cases. While these high-end projects are less common, local service providers are equipped to handle them when needed.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
